Buying Guide

Choose heat level for your palate

Mild options suit families and simple cheese quesadillas, while hot or Hatch varieties add a spicy kick—match heat to ingredients and diners' tolerance

Diced vs. whole peppers

Diced chiles (e.g., diced-green-chiles) disperse evenly for consistent bites; larger roasted pieces provide more texture and visible roast flavor

Consider roast style and flavor

Fire-roasted or flame-roasted chiles add smoky depth that complements melting cheeses; plain canned chiles deliver a cleaner, fresher green taste

Pack size and meal planning

Bulk multipacks and larger cans (24-pack or 40 oz options) offer better value for frequent use, while 4–16 oz packs suit occasional cooking

Check sodium and ingredient list

Look for short ingredient lists and moderate sodium if you monitor salt intake; some brands prioritize simple roasted chiles without additives
